Rome - Part Three - The Pantheon

Rome 2008 Part 1 044

By far my favourite individual site in Rome is the Pantheon (http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Pantheon,_Rome). This is the oldest complete building in Rome, and was built 125AD as a temple to "all the gods", but is now consecrated as a Catholic church.

The building has to be seen to be believed, I cannot describe the feeling you get when you first walk in, or the sheer size of the place. Photos give you no idea of scale or atmosphere. It is so amazing I had to revisit it again to really try and take it all in.
